Abstract

The utility model relates to a tie hepatic portal blocker for blocking the blood flow at the hepatic portal in partial hepatectomy, which consists of an elliptical column tube-shaped sleeve, an elliptical column-shaped column insertion pole and a line strip. One end of the column insertion pole is sheathed in the sleeve and can moves along the axial direction of the sleeve, a spring is pressing arranged between the sleeve and the column insertion pole, the side walls of two wide surfaces of the sleeve are symmetrically and respectively provided with a line strip penetration hole, another line strip penetration hole is arranged on the column insertion pole, the line strip can sequentially pass through the line strip penetration holes of the two components, when the two components carry out the forward motion to a certain position under the external force, the line strip penetration holes thereon are mutually closed, the line strip can be moved conveniently in the holes, when the external force is removed, the line strip penetration holes on the two components are mutually dislocated, and the line strip is clamped and fixed. The product has the advantages of simple and novel structure, compact and delicate model, convenient operation, least effort, easy cleaning and disinfection, good working stability and so on, which can also effectively improve the efficiency of partial hepatectomy and ensure operation effects.

Description

Bow-tie hepatic portal occlusion device
Technical field
This utility model belongs to technical field of medical instruments, relates to the hepatic portal occlusion device that is used for vascular inflow occlusion portion blood flow in a kind of operation on liver.
Background technology
The liver ablation is the method for the optimum or malignant tumor of treatment liver at present commonly used, and vascular inflow occlusion portion blood flow, to reduce intraoperative hemorrhage then be perform the operation successful crucial behave of decision.The mode that adopts for vascular inflow occlusion portion blood flow in clinic operation was in the past: the single line band is walked around hepatic portal portion, steel wire hook of reuse is after one section plastic cement pipe passes, hook goes out this tape, clamps tape with strength with vascular forceps then, blocks the blood flow through hepatic portal portion whereby.But this mode is the also corresponding deficiencies such as inconvenient operation, effort, functional reliability difference that have in concrete the execution, have reduced surgical effect to a certain extent.
The utility model content
The purpose of this utility model is to overcome the deficiency that prior art exists, and then a kind of novelty simple in structure, easy to operate, job stability and good reliability is provided, can guarantees surgical effect and alleviates the bow-tie hepatic portal occlusion device of medical worker's labor intensity.
Be used to realize that the technical solution of foregoing invention purpose is such: this bow-tie hepatic portal occlusion device is by sleeve pipe, inserting column bar and single line band are formed, wherein, said sleeve pipe is a single-ended occluded ellipse stylostome, said inserting column bar is oval column rod member, its end is sleeved in the sleeve pipe and can moves axially along sleeve pipe, between sleeve pipe and inserting column bar, press and be equipped with a spring, respectively have a tape perforation in telescopic two wide side-walls symmetries, on the bar wall of inserting column bar, have a tape perforation, said tape can pass in the tape perforation by two members successively, when sleeve pipe and inserting column bar under external force during move toward one another to a fixed position, tape perforation on it is involutory mutually, tape can conveniently move in the hole, after external force is removed, tape perforation mutual dislocation under the effect of inner spring power on two members is fixedly clamped tape.When this block device is used in the Rhizoma Atractylodis Macrocephalae, with tape around hepatic portal after one week, earlier after pass in the tape of opening on sleeve pipe and the inserting column bar perforation, clutch the two ends of block device with hands, after making the tape perforation of sleeve pipe and inserting column bar involutory mutually block device is pushed ahead, treat to unclamp finger after hepatic portal portion blood flow is blocked, tape will be stuck because of the elastic reset of spring, then tape will be fixed on this position, vascular inflow occlusion portion blood flow with being stabilized; Use the two ends of clutching block device after finishing again also it oppositely to be pulled back,, and then taken out smoothly so tape will be released because of the spring contraction.
Compared with prior art, the utlity model has novelty simple in structure, the small and exquisite exquisiteness of moulding, easy to operate, laborsaving, be convenient to advantages such as cleaning and sterilizing, good operating stability, can effectively improve the efficient of liver part resection operation, guarantee surgical effect.

The specific embodiment
As shown in the figure, the construction profile of bow-tie hepatic portal occlusion device described in the utility model such as same small and exquisite cassette knot, it is formed by mutually nestable sleeve pipe 1, inserting column bar 3 with from the tape 4 that the two part body passes.Sleeve pipe 1 is the stainless steel cylindroid shape pipe of a single-ended sealing, and inserting column bar 3 is that one one end is sleeved on the oval column rod member of Stainless Steel system in the sleeve pipe 1, and horizontal between sleeve pipe 1 and inserting column bar 3 have a spring 2.Two wide side-walls symmetries at sleeve pipe 1 respectively have a tape perforation 1a who supplies tape 4 to penetrate and pass, correspondingly on the bar wall of inserting column bar 3 also have one and penetrate the tape perforation 3a that passes for tape 4, the tapes perforation of two places 1a, 3a can involutory (or staggering) when applying (or not applying) external force situation.In addition, be provided with the inner shield ring platform at the pipe edgewise of sleeve pipe 1, the two leptoprosopy side place symmetries that stretch into sleeve pipe 1 rod end at inserting column bar 3 respectively are provided with a retaining salient point, can stop inserting column bar 3 to be deviate from by sleeve pipe 1.Sleeve pipe 1 and inserting column bar 3 opposite external side all inwardly slightly cave in, and are provided with the granulous point of some sand on concave face.The person grips with handled easily.
In the actual fabrication structure, when sleeve pipe 1 and inserting column bar 3 be nested with in place after, the length of this block device is 2.0cm~2.5cm, the outer wide footpath of sleeve pipe 1 is 1.0cm~2.5cm, outer narrow footpath is 0.5cm~0.8cm, and tape 4 is about and is 30cm, respectively is surrounded by the long quoit of 1cm at the two ends of tape 4, be convenient to tape and from aperture, pass, and be beneficial to the fluoroscopic machine searching.
